Ingredients

3 tablespoons butter2 cups chopped crisp apples, unpeeled (about 2 medium apples)1 teaspoon grated fresh gingerroot1 cup shelled roasted pistachios2 teaspoons Dijon mustard1 package (5 ounces) fresh baby spinach1 cup whole-milk ricotta cheese2 tablespoons honeyCoarsely ground pepper

Preparation

In a large skillet, melt butter over medium-high heat. Add apples and ginger; cook and stir until apples soften and begin to caramelize, 3-5 minutes. Stir in pistachios and Dijon mustard. Reduce heat; simmer 5 minutes, stirring occasionally.

Place spinach on a serving platter. Pour two-thirds of apple mixture over spinach. Add spoonfuls of ricotta cheese; top with remaining apple mixture. Drizzle with honey. Add fresh pepper to taste.
